  3. We are recreating our workflow from Quark to Publisher at the moment. Our imported images have a noticeable red/magenta shift when converted into PDF. Only really shows up when printed. We have done a back to back test using the Quark and Publisher generated PDFs and there is a pretty big difference. We have used Fogra 27 and Euroscale V2 for both when creating the PDF but no difference from that end....anyone got any ideas. Thanks in advance.

  6. We are transitioning from Quark. We need to import plain text (from emails) into text fields already set up on our templates. The templates have font/size/colour options already in place and we need to just cut and paste in the new text and have it keep the same style as the template text. We don't want to create styles and have to apply them to each text field after we import....I am sure it is a simple fix ...can you let me know how to do this. Cheers Nick.
